About GTI Energy

GTI Energy, a division of GTI Fabrication, is a leader in industrial modular fabrication, serving the energy, defense, and heavy industrial markets. With advanced engineering and manufacturing operations in Arizona and New York, GTI designs and builds mission-critical modular systems — including containerized energy systems, data centers, and large-scale power distribution enclosures.

As we continue to grow, GTI is expanding its internal recruiting function to attract top technical and engineering talent that drives our innovation and production excellence.

Position Overview

The Senior Technical Recruiter will own the full-cycle recruiting process for complex engineering and manufacturing roles across GTI’s organization. This role is ideal for a high-performing recruiter with deep experience sourcing Mechanical, Electrical, Industrial, and Structural Engineers and building repeatable, scalable pipelines of technical talent.

You’ll be a key partner to engineering and operations leaders, developing proactive sourcing strategies, optimizing talent funnels, and building long-term networks to support GTI’s continued growth.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ead full-cycle recruiting for engineering, manufacturing, and leadership positions — from intake through offer acceptance.

  • Partner with hiring managers to define technical requirements, market positioning, and role expectations.

  • Build and execute strategic sourcing plans to identify and engage engineering talent using LinkedIn Recruiter, advanced Boolean searches, and third-party tools (Chrome extensions, niche platforms, competitor mapping, etc.).

  • Create and manage project-based sourcing campaigns to saturate the talent pool within key disciplines (Mechanical, Electrical, Industrial, Structural).

  • Build repeatable pipelines for high-volume or recurring roles, ensuring GTI can hire critical talent quickly and efficiently.

  • Use data-driven insights to measure pipeline health, sourcing channel effectiveness, and conversion rates.

  • Manage candidate relationships to ensure a high-quality, responsive, and professional experience.

  • Collaborate with HR, leadership, and operations to forecast hiring needs and prioritize key roles.

  • Maintain ATS hygiene, track progress against time-to-fill targets, and contribute to reporting and dashboarding.

  • Represent GTI Energy’s culture and mission in all candidate interactions.
